55问答网
所有问题
当前搜索:
rowkey设计原则
HBase性能优化-
Rowkey
&列族
设计
答:
1、必须在设计上保证RowKey的唯一性
。由于在HBase中数据存储是Key-Value形式,若向HBase中同一张表插入相同RowKey的数据,则原先存在的数据会被新的数据覆盖。设计的RowKey应均匀的分布在各个HBase节点上,避免数据热点现象。2、rowkey:行键设计的三个原则唯一必须在设计上保证其唯一性。3、properties.sh...
HBase中
rowkey设计
有哪些注意点
答:
rowkey:行键 设计的三个原则 唯一 必须在设计上保证其唯一性
。由于在HBase中数据存储是Key-Value形式,若HBase中同一表插入相同Rowkey,则原先的数据会被覆盖掉(如果表的version设置为1的话),所以务必保证Rowkey的唯一性 排序 HBase的Rowkey是按照ASCII有序设计的,我们在设计Rowkey时要充分利用这点。...
哪些方法可以使得
rowkey
满足散列
原则
答:
将rowkey的高位作为散列字段、在rowkey的前面增加随机数
。1、将rowkey的高位作为散列字段,由程序随机生成,低位放时间字段。2、在rowkey的前面增加随机数,具体就是给rowkey分配一个随机前缀以使得本身和之前的rowkey的开头不同。
怎样将关系型数据表转换至hbase数据表
答:
二、
设计原则
:(1)
rowkey
a) rowkey是hbase的key-value存储中的key,通常使用用户要查询的字段作为rowkey ,查询结果作为value ,HBase中
RowKey
是按照字典序排列的 (2)Column Family的设计需遵循:a) 不同Column Family的数据,在物理上是分开的,尽量避免一次请求需要拿到的Column分布在不同的Col...
hbase中的数据以什么形式存储
答:
2、rowkey:行键设计的三个原则唯一必须在设计上保证其唯一性
。3、properties.sh:在里面配置hbase,hadoop等环境变量,里面目前默认是我们测试集群的配置作为参考。注意一些基础的jar包一定要有。config:xml格式的配置hbase导出数据的信息。在海量导出数据或根据rowkey到处数据的时候使用。4、LSM-Tree模式的...
hbase 元素之间的关系怎么存
答:
所以你先去网上看看
rowkey
的
设计原则
,比如长度原则等等,然后根据自己业务,哪些查询经常用到,哪些不会用到,想要用hbase实现那种非常灵活的类似关系数据库的查询是不理智的。3、楼上的兄弟说得对,还有region热点的问题,如果你的hbase数据不是那种每天增量的数据,建议跑个mapreduce对你的数据进行各评判...
hbase 一张表 能存多少数据
答:
所以你先去网上看看
rowkey
的
设计原则
,比如长度原则等等,然后根据自己业务,哪些查询经常用到,哪些不会用到,想要用hbase实现那种非常灵活的类似关系数据库的查询是不理智的。3、楼上的兄弟说得对,还有region热点的问题,如果你的hbase数据不是那种每天增量的数据,建议跑个mapreduce对你的数据进行各评判...
如果有几百亿条数据,如何在hbase表中存放?
答:
所以你先去网上看看
rowkey
的
设计原则
,比如长度原则等等,然后根据自己业务,哪些查询经常用到,哪些不会用到,想要用hbase实现那种非常灵活的类似关系数据库的查询是不理智的。3、楼上的兄弟说得对,还有region热点的问题,如果你的hbase数据不是那种每天增量的数据,建议跑个mapreduce对你的数据进行各评判...
影响数据检索效率的几个因素
答:
基于尽可能让数据读取本地化的
原则
,检索应该尽可能地使用顺序读而不是随机读。如果可以的话,把主存储的
row key
或者clustered index
设计
为和查询提交一样的。时间序列如果都是按时间查,那么按时间做的row key可以非常高效地以顺序读的方式把数据拉取出来。类似地,按列存储的数据如果要把一个列的数据都取出来加和的...
Hbase读写原理
视频时间 12:12
1
2
涓嬩竴椤
其他人还搜
hbase rowkey设计原则
rowkey设计的原则
设计模式和设计原则
hbase查询rowkey设计
rowkey设计
hbase设计原则
hbase行健设计原则
hbase表设计原则
设计原则